**Ticket: Config drift in Fernwick template renderer**

New folks: the Fernwick render tier caches compiled templates, and staging has drifted from prod. Staging renders at ~40ms p95, prod at 180ms, because cache TTL and precompile flags were hand-edited during the Larkhaven incident and never reverted. This is why your local benchmarks won't match prod. Fix is to restore the canonical values via the deploy pipeline, not by SSH edits. The canonical values are as follows.

config for kagup-hahig:
druwyn:
  pin: 2801
  metrics_host: metrics.druwyn.zemvarlabs.internal
  tenant: sorius
  seal: seal_798a43d7

Ticket: TAXR-412 — Config drift in rate-lookup cache

The Ledgerline tax-rate cache in the east cluster is serving stale TTLs; its settings no longer match the declared baseline, likely from a manual hotfix last month. Symptom: mismatched rates between clusters on some jurisdictions. Please reconcile the node against source control and restart. The expected service configuration values are listed below.

settings of fadup-kajog:
[casox]
port = 3000
team = jorix
host = casox.paliqio.example
region = lower-4
access_code = ac_dd069a
timeout_ms = 750

Subject: Rate-parity checker — new owner

As of this cycle, the Gullwing rate-parity checker moves from the Pricing team to Platform Integrity. This covers the scraper schedules, the mismatch scoring rules, and the alerting thresholds. For the changes currently in review, no action is needed beyond updating the reviewer list. Going forward, all pull requests against the checker require approval from the person named below.

account owner for bawip-tahag: Raleth Quenok